[Utility] Placate another GCC warning.
authorDavide Italiano <davide@freebsd.org>
Thu, 20 Apr 2017 14:45:33 +0000 (14:45 +0000)
committerDavide Italiano <davide@freebsd.org>
Thu, 20 Apr 2017 14:45:33 +0000 (14:45 +0000)
Differential Revision:  https://reviews.llvm.org/D32137

llvm-svn: 300845

lldb/source/Plugins/Process/Utility/RegisterContextPOSIX_mips64.cpp

index 207c693..6a55947 100644 (file)
@@ -55,9 +55,10 @@ RegisterContextPOSIX_mips64::RegisterContextPOSIX_mips64(
       m_registers_count[i] = reg_set_ptr->num_registers;
   }
 
-  assert(m_num_registers == m_registers_count[gpr_registers_count] +
-                            m_registers_count[fpr_registers_count] +
-                            m_registers_count[msa_registers_count]);
+  assert(m_num_registers ==
+         static_cast<uint32_t>(m_registers_count[gpr_registers_count] +
+                               m_registers_count[fpr_registers_count] +
+                               m_registers_count[msa_registers_count]));
 
   // elf-core yet to support ReadFPR()
   ProcessSP base = CalculateProcess();